Output 66a30474baaf1140f2e8b45fc57e4e1e08b2bf9063a92c78f1d4394b9367c701:14

value
13483351
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bedcd4f8b014c815ba13c6ab10e0a25a117f3c1 OP_EQUAL
address
38cVUhkBuKohy9wdvESJ9Gks2nDU94s4et
transaction
66a30474baaf1140f2e8b45fc57e4e1e08b2bf9063a92c78f1d4394b9367c701
confirmations
352147
spent
true